非关系型数据库用途文档介绍

非关系型数据库(NoSQL)是一种不同于传统关系型数据库的数据存储技术,它以数据模型、数据存储和数据处理方式的不同,为解决大规模数据存储、高性能计算和实时分析等需求提供了新的解决方案,本文将详细介绍非关系型数据库的用途、特点及其在各个领域的应用。
非关系型数据库的特点
-
数据模型灵活:非关系型数据库支持多种数据模型,如键值对、文档、列族、图等,能够适应不同类型的数据存储需求。
-
高扩展性:非关系型数据库采用分布式存储架构,可以水平扩展,满足大规模数据存储和计算需求。
-
高性能:非关系型数据库在读写性能、数据检索等方面具有优势,适用于高性能计算场景。
-
易于维护:非关系型数据库通常采用自动化管理,降低运维成本。
-
支持多种编程语言:非关系型数据库支持多种编程语言,方便开发者进行开发。
非关系型数据库的用途
大规模数据存储
非关系型数据库在处理大规模数据存储方面具有显著优势,分布式文件系统Hadoop的底层存储系统HBase,采用列族存储结构,能够高效存储海量数据。
高性能计算

非关系型数据库在数据处理和计算方面表现出色,Redis、Memcached等内存数据库,可以快速处理大量数据,适用于实时计算场景。
实时分析
非关系型数据库在实时分析领域具有广泛应用,Elasticsearch、MongoDB等数据库,能够实时处理和分析海量数据,为用户提供实时搜索和数据分析服务。
分布式系统
非关系型数据库在分布式系统中扮演重要角色,分布式缓存系统Memcached,可以缓存热点数据,减轻后端服务压力。
物联网(IoT)
非关系型数据库在物联网领域具有广泛应用,IoT设备产生的海量数据,可以通过非关系型数据库进行存储、处理和分析。
非关系型数据库在各个领域的应用
社交网络
非关系型数据库在社交网络领域具有广泛应用,Facebook、Twitter等社交平台,采用非关系型数据库存储用户关系、动态等信息。
电子商务

非关系型数据库在电子商务领域具有广泛应用,电商平台可以使用非关系型数据库存储商品信息、用户行为数据等。
金融行业
非关系型数据库在金融行业具有广泛应用,银行、证券公司等金融机构可以使用非关系型数据库存储交易数据、用户信息等。
物流行业
非关系型数据库在物流行业具有广泛应用,物流企业可以使用非关系型数据库存储货物信息、运输路线等。
医疗健康
非关系型数据库在医疗健康领域具有广泛应用,医疗机构可以使用非关系型数据库存储病历、医疗影像等数据。
非关系型数据库凭借其独特的优势,在各个领域得到了广泛应用,随着大数据、云计算等技术的发展,非关系型数据库将继续发挥重要作用,为各行各业提供高效、可靠的数据存储和计算服务。
图片来源于AI模型,如侵权请联系管理员。作者:酷小编,如若转载,请注明出处:https://www.kufanyun.com/ask/261403.html

